package com.android.cts.net;
import com.android.cts.tradefed.build.CtsBuildHelper;
import com.android.ddmlib.testrunner.RemoteAndroidTestRunner;
import com.android.ddmlib.testrunner.TestIdentifier;
import com.android.ddmlib.testrunner.TestResult;
import com.android.ddmlib.testrunner.TestResult.TestStatus;
import com.android.ddmlib.testrunner.TestRunResult;
import com.android.tradefed.build.IBuildInfo;
import com.android.tradefed.device.DeviceNotAvailableException;
import com.android.tradefed.testtype.DeviceTestCase;
import com.android.tradefed.testtype.IAbi;
import com.android.tradefed.testtype.IAbiReceiver;
import com.android.tradefed.testtype.IBuildReceiver;
import com.android.tradefed.device.DeviceNotAvailableException;
import com.android.tradefed.device.ITestDevice;
import com.android.tradefed.result.CollectingTestListener;
import java.util.Map;
public class HostsideNetworkTests extends DeviceTestCase implements IAbiReceiver, IBuildReceiver {
private static final String TEST_PKG = "com.android.cts.net.hostside";
private static final String TEST_APK = "CtsHostsideNetworkTestsApp.apk";
private IAbi mAbi;
private CtsBuildHelper mCtsBuild;
@Override
public void setAbi(IAbi abi) {
mAbi = abi;
}
@Override
public void setBuild(IBuildInfo buildInfo) {
mCtsBuild = CtsBuildHelper.createBuildHelper(buildInfo);
}
@Override
protected void setUp() throws Exception {
super.setUp();
assertNotNull(mAbi);
assertNotNull(mCtsBuild);
getDevice().uninstallPackage(TEST_PKG);
assertNull(getDevice().installPackage(mCtsBuild.getTestApp(TEST_APK), false));
}
@Override
protected void tearDown() throws Exception {
super.tearDown();
getDevice().uninstallPackage(TEST_PKG);
}
public void testVpn() throws Exception {
runDeviceTests(TEST_PKG, ".VpnTest");
}
public void runDeviceTests(String packageName, String testClassName)
throws DeviceNotAvailableException {
RemoteAndroidTestRunner testRunner = new RemoteAndroidTestRunner(packageName,
"android.support.test.runner.AndroidJUnitRunner", getDevice().getIDevice());
final CollectingTestListener listener = new CollectingTestListener();
getDevice().runInstrumentationTests(testRunner, listener);
final TestRunResult result = listener.getCurrentRunResults();
if (result.isRunFailure()) {
throw new AssertionError("Failed to successfully run device tests for "
+ result.getName() + ": " + result.getRunFailureMessage());
}
if (result.hasFailedTests()) {
// build a meaningful error message
StringBuilder errorBuilder = new StringBuilder("on-device tests failed:\n");
for (Map.Entry<TestIdentifier, TestResult> resultEntry :
result.getTestResults().entrySet()) {
if (!resultEntry.getValue().getStatus().equals(TestStatus.PASSED)) {
errorBuilder.append(resultEntry.getKey().toString());
errorBuilder.append(":\n");
errorBuilder.append(resultEntry.getValue().getStackTrace());
}
}
throw new AssertionError(errorBuilder.toString());
}
}
}
